More2021-11-4 Quartz is a manmade stone (an “engineered stone“) constructed from around 93% quartz (a rock-like mineral) and 7% artificial resins, polymers, pigments, and other small pieces.You can find out how it’s made here.Sometimes additives like metal and glass are used to make up the 7% if they give the quartz a certain look.

More2021-2-3 Perhaps the biggest difference between quartz and granite is that granite is a natural stone that is harvested from the earth, cut, and polished. Quartz is man-made from a process that combines ground quartz and polymer resins. More2020-8-11 Similar to quartz, granite countertops are extremely durable and long lasting. The main point of differentiation between granite and quartz is that granite by nature is quite porous. Kitchen countertop manufacturers will suggest sealing the surface. Left unsealed, staining can occur, and bacteria can be absorbed into the material.

More2021-9-7 Still, granite countertops come out ahead as they are 100 percent stone. In contrast, quartz countertops are about 93% natural materials, with the remainder of color pigments and polymer resins, which materials are combined. And the manufacturing process for natural granite produces fewer carbon emissions than quartz.
